P0100
Mass Air Flow (MAF) Sensor Circuit
Detailed Description
The MAF sensor signal voltage is outside the range expected by the ECM, which cannot determine the actual amount of air entering the engine.
Possible Causes
MAF sensor dirty or damaged
MAF sensor power or ground poor
Sensor signal wire open or shorted
Severe air intake system leak
ECM fault.
Solutions & Repair Guide
First clean the MAF sensor using a dedicated cleaner; Check the sensor connector and wiring harness; Inspect intake piping for cracks or disconnections; Measure MAF sensor signal output voltage (typically 0.5-1.2V at idle); Replace the MAF sensor if necessary.
